GUZMAN LLANOS, María José; GUZMAN ZAMUDIO, José L. y LLANOS DE LOS REYES-GARCIA, M.J.. Significance of anaemia in the different stages of life. Enferm. glob. [online]. 2016, vol.15, n.43, pp.407-418. ISSN 1695-6141.
Overview: Anemia is very common in primary care consultations and pediatrics, and IDA is the cause of 50% of all cases of anemia. Methodology: Literature review and documentary descriptive analysis of the pathogenesis of iron-deficiency anemia, the basic diagnostic tests to study IDA and the significance of such using a specific time period in the documentary search and inclusion criteria that takes into account factors that are analyzed in the study: Ideas about the metabolism of iron. Ideas about hematopoiesis. Laboratory diagnosis and classification of anemia. Clinical features of iron deficiency anemia. Causes of iron deficiency. Results and conclusion: The staged documentary study covers the publications on the pathogenesis of iron deficiency anemia, the basic diagnostic tests to study the IDA and the significance of such, and it shows how important this data is for professional nursing in the area of primary care and pediatrics, to identify it and act accordingly.
Palabras clave : Iron deficiency anemia; anemia in pregnancy; anemia in seniors.
